August 17, 2026 –Â Indie developer Megasploot has released Nimbit Frontier, a cozy creature-raising adventure and life sim, into Early Access on Steam. After accumulating more than 40,000 Steam wishlists ahead of launch, the game is available for $13.99 USD, with a 10% launch discount.
After five years in development, Nimbit Frontier launches with 20+ hours of content, featuring 42 Nimbit species to discover and nurture, three biomes to explore, 24 NPCs to meet, habitat building, town life, and expeditions into the mysterious Underwild.
Unlike traditional creature collectors, Nimbit Frontier is built around eventually letting your creatures go.
At its core, Nimbit Frontier is Chao Garden meets Stardew Valley, with light action-roguelike dungeon crawling tying the experience together.
Players venture beyond Star’s End to recover genetic fragments of lost species, hatch Nimbits back at home, create habitats suited to their needs, care for them, teach them survival skills, and eventually release them back into the wild.

Nimbit Frontier’s Early Access period is currently expected to last approximately 18 months. Megasploot has been working closely with its playtesting community for more than a year and plans to continue incorporating player feedback throughout Early Access.

About Megasploot
Nimbit Frontier is created by Megasploot, a two-person wife-and-husband team based in the Pacific Northwest. She handles the artwork and world design, while he handles the game design and programming. Together, they have spent years crafting a cozy adventure about creature care, discovery, and exploration.
